Smart plugs for automation

Some of the less expensive accessories for smart homes include smart plugs. These turn “dumb” accessories like traditional Christmas lights into smart products and are essential for automation and routines. You can also buy weather-resistant. outdoor-specific smart plugs with for all of your outdoor decorations. There are many ways to set up smart plugs, but I recommend using them in automation.

They can be used to control your house lights and outdoor-specific decorations like lawn displays. They can automatically turn on when the sun sets without you having to remember to do it and without using unnecessary electricity. You can use the same principle indoors for lighting your Christmas tree. Some good brands to look at include Meross, Wemo, and TP-Link.

Smart doorbells with holiday tones

Smart Doorbells, like the ones from Ring or Arlo, are essential for having extra security around your home, especially during the holiday season when you’re expecting higher than regular traffic and deliveries. Yet, some of these doorbells have additional fun features. For example, with Ring, you can change the “Chimetone” to something more festive to get your guests in the holiday mood before they step foot inside.
